Root cause review of the Tarnwick outage found that the runbook wiki enforced role-based access too coarsely: the "viewer" role could not open the mitigation pages, delaying response by 22 minutes. Future maintainers should note that wiki roles are synced nightly from the Ledgewood directory, so manual grants get reverted. The fix is to add runbook spaces to the default on-call role bundle rather than granting per-page exceptions. The role bundle definition and sync schedule are documented on the internal page below.

operations page: https://confluence.norvacorp.corp/spaces/dash/dash/a5a4e1c207d6

Handover: LockerLoop access flow — from Priya to Danek. Quick recap for the sync: the laundry-locker unlock now goes QR scan → token check → latch release, and the retry logic finally respects the 30-second cooldown. Watch the staging kiosk at the Fennwick Commons site; it drops tokens when the Wi-Fi blips. I moved the fallback codes into the Stowbin vault. To reopen the vault if you get locked out, use the recovery passphrase below.

unlock words, yagep-fahof: belix-rusvan-casdor-gorox-aldath-norael-istix-quenael-fraeth-silael

Ticket VR-2214: The resizr-batch CLI started failing yesterday with 401 errors against the Ombrel asset service. Cause: the service credential expired at the end of last month and the renewal job was never scheduled. As the contractor taking this over, please update the CLI config on the build runner, re-run the smoke batch of 50 images, and confirm output dimensions match the manifest. A replacement credential has been issued with the same scopes as before. The new key for the Ombrel asset service is below.

service key, bajog-yahop: kto7_mMHVCpJ